The purpose of this study is to determine how interventions in the amount of physical activity in daily life affect knee pain in the elderly.
Efficacy
Change in knee pain reported as a clinical diagnosis or validated self-report measure (e.g.,Knee injury and Osteoarthritis Outcome Score(KOOS), Western Ontario and McMaster Universities Osteoarthritis Index(WOMAC))from baseline

(1) It is an exercise and educational intervention aimed at increasing physical activity.
(2) The intervention is non-face-to-face or face-to-face for the first time only.
(3) The outcome includes a measure of physical activity.
(4) The article is an original research paper
(5) The study design is a randomized controlled trial
(6) The article is written in English or Japanese
(1) The intervention consists of multiple programs.
(2) The intervention does not aim to increase physical activity.
(3) Multiple face-to-face interventions are conducted.
(4) Not enough data are reported to integrate the results.

Methods: In June 2021, PubMed, Cochrane Central Register of Controlled Trials (CENTRAL), Physiotherapy Evidence Database (PEDro), Cumulative Index to Nursing and Allied Health Literature (CINAHL), and the Central Journal of Medicine (Igaku Chujo). Searches were conducted using a combination of free-text words and Medical Subject Headings (MeSH) terms. Two concepts, "intervention" and "outcome," were combined using the "AND" operator. Intervention was defined as an exercise or educational intervention aimed at increasing physical activity. Outcome was defined as knee pain. For each concept, synonyms and MeSH terms were combined with the "OR" operator.
